What are entry level computer science OPT jobs?

Entry level computer science OPT jobs are positions suitable for recent graduates with a computer science degree who are working in the United States under the Optional Practical Training (OPT) program. These roles typically include software developer, QA tester, data analyst, and IT support positions, and are designed to provide practical experience in the field. OPT allows international students to work in their area of study for up to 12 months after graduation, or up to 36 months if they qualify for the STEM extension. Entry level positions usually require basic coding skills, problem-solving abilities, and familiarity with common programming languages. These jobs often serve as a stepping stone to more advanced roles in the tech industry.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an Entry Level Computer Science professional,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Entry Level Computer Science professional, you generally need a solid understanding of programming fundamentals, problem-solving skills, and a bachelor's degree in computer science or a related field. Familiarity with programming languages like Python, Java, or C++, and experience using version control systems such as Git are typically expected. Strong communication, teamwork, and adaptability help you collaborate effectively and learn quickly in dynamic environments. These skills and qualities are crucial for developing reliable software, integrating into technical teams, and advancing in the fast-evolving tech industry.

What are some typical projects or tasks an Entry Level Computer Science professional can expect to work on during their first year?

As an Entry Level Computer Science professional, you can expect to be involved in a variety of tasks such as debugging code, writing simple programs or modules, assisting with software testing, and updating documentation. You'll likely work under the guidance of more experienced developers and collaborate with team members to support larger projects. This role provides a strong foundation in real-world software development practices and offers valuable exposure to agile workflows, code reviews, and version control systems. Over time, you'll have opportunities to take on more complex assignments and contribute ideas as you gain experience.
